Walter Bonatti: The Lone Warrior from the Mountains

Walter Bonatti continues to be amongst the greatest figures in the background of mountaineering—an alpinist whose bravery, integrity, and amazing achievements elevated him to famous position. Born in 1930 in Bergamo, Italy, Bonatti turned recognised not only for climbing several of the environment’s most challenging peaks, but for doing this with a purity of fashion that emphasized self-reliance and respect to the mountains. His title is synonymous with journey, endurance, and the relentless pursuit of fact inside of a sport typically shaped by myth and controversy.

Bonatti’s climbing career commenced during the rugged Italian Alps, in which his purely natural expertise quickly became evident. With the age of twenty, he was pushing into territory few dared take a look at. His early achievements within the Grandes Jorasses as well as the Matterhorn currently signaled the arrival of a unprecedented climber. Still it had been his function in the 1954 Italian expedition to K2 that thrust him into Global prominence—and controversy.

The K2 expedition marked one of the darkest chapters of Bonatti’s vocation. At only 24 several years old, he was tasked with carrying oxygen cylinders to the ultimate camp for the summit workforce. Pressured to bivouac right away at Severe altitude without shelter—a in close proximity to-death problem—Bonatti survived by means of sheer willpower. Though the summit was eventually reached by other climbers, Bonatti was unfairly accused of employing their oxygen. For many years he fought to very clear his identify, and ultimately the reality emerged: he had acted heroically, along with the accusations were being Bogus. This ordeal formed Bonatti’s character, reinforcing his deep commitment to honesty in the environment in which narrative generally overshadowed facts.

Adhering to K2, Bonatti started a duration of climbing that many historians check out as the most amazing in present day mountaineering. He pioneered new routes on a lot of the Alps’ most feared faces, including the legendary “Bonatti Pillar” around the Dru, a masterpiece of specialized issues and Daring eyesight. He tackled these routes by yourself or with small aid, embracing a style that highlighted his immense strength and psychological resilience.

What produced Bonatti Excellent was not merely his Bodily ability but his philosophical approach to climbing. For him, mountaineering was not a conquest—it absolutely was a dialogue between man and mother nature. He considered in climbing ethically, devoid of abnormal reliance on synthetic aids. This dedication defined his most daring solo ascents, many of which remain benchmarks in the climbing environment.

In 1965, at just 35 decades outdated, Bonatti retired from Excessive climbing, believing the sport was drifting clear of its purest values. His retirement wasn't a withdrawal but a change. He shifted his energies into world-wide exploration, traveling via deserts, jungles, and polar locations for a author and photographer. His adventurous spirit by no means pale—it simply just observed new landscapes.

Walter Bonatti died in 2011, but his legacy endures in every single climber who values integrity approximately achievement.
